Assessing Lawyer Experience



When selecting a criminal defense lawyer, assessing their experience is essential. You'll want to dive deep into their past cases to comprehend not simply the quantity of situations they've managed, however the quality of outcomes attained.

It's not almost the length of time they have actually been exercising, however how well they have actually handled instances similar to yours. Look for specifics: Have they handled fees like your own before? The amount of of those cases mosted likely to test, and what were the outcomes?

It's essential you recognize they have actually got a strong record with successful outcomes in scenarios comparable to what you're dealing with. Experience in a courtroom is specifically invaluable if your case goes to trial. You don't just desire someone that knows the legislation; you require a person that maneuvers successfully within the court room characteristics.

Additionally, check where they have actually gained their experience. Someone who knows with the local courts and judges can be useful. They'll comprehend neighborhood treatments and subtleties which can play a crucial role in the defense technique.

Picking a person skilled can make all the difference. Ensure their experience straightens closely with your demands, providing you the most effective chance at a beneficial end result.

Assessing Interaction Abilities



Evaluating interaction abilities is necessary when selecting a criminal defense lawyer. You'll desire a person who not only speaks plainly but additionally listens successfully. Your lawyer needs to make you really feel recognized and make sure that you grasp every element of your case.

Seek an attorney who can describe intricate lawful terms in uncomplicated language. They need to be approachable, making it very easy for you to ask questions and share problems. Notification how they communicate throughout your first appointment. Are they client? Do fraud defense give in-depth responses or thrill with explanations?

Good interaction also indicates staying in touch. Your attorney should upgrade you consistently about your situation's progression. Inspect if they prefer emails, call, or in person meetings and see if their favored technique straightens with your requirements.

Lastly, consider their ability to interact under pressure. Court settings are high-stress settings, and you require someone who can verbalize your protection plainly and convincingly in front of a judge and jury.

Recognizing Defense Techniques



Recognizing the various defense methods your attorney might employ is crucial to effectively navigating your situation. simply click the following website page depends upon the specifics of the costs you're facing and the proof versus you. Allow's look into what you need to recognize.

To begin with, if there's a lack of evidence, your lawyer could say that the prosecution hasn't met its burden of proof. Remember, it's not your job to show virtue; it's the prosecutor's job to show guilt past a sensible doubt. If they can't, you must be acquitted.


One more typical technique is self-defense, specifically in cases entailing costs like assault or homicide. If you were protecting yourself, your lawyer might utilize this strategy to justify your activities legitimately. This needs verifying that your perception of threat was reasonable which your reaction was in proportion to that danger.

Occasionally, your protection may entail questioning the legality of just how proof was gotten. If law enforcement breached your civil liberties throughout the investigation, evidence may be reduced, which can dramatically weaken the prosecution's case.

Ultimately, your attorney might bargain an appeal deal if it offers your best interest. This commonly occurs if the proof versus you is strong however there are mitigating elements that might lead to lowered fees or sentencing.

Recognizing these techniques helps you review your situation better with your lawyer.
